av8iimech Posted October 30, 2008 Author Share Posted October 30, 2008 (edited) Yes the "Pt. 2" sheet will have two Skyhawks (A-4B & A-4C) and two A-6A Intruders! Both sheets are in work and will most likely be released at the same time. As for the F4U-4, the yellow markings are more of an educated guess. It was a difficult decission to go with yellow but as you know, color pictures from that time frame are near impossible to come by and being that the b&w pics we used were taken during the short time frame that the color of USMC markings had switched to yellow, we decided to go with it. If anyone has any other information pertaining to this subject, we would love to get confirmation either way. It is not too late to make the necessary changes.
